How they compare
Kazakhstan currently reports 2.52 million LSU against 1.69 million LSU in Argentina, a difference of 828,870 LSU.
That makes Kazakhstan's figure about 1.5 times Argentina's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 32 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Argentina ahead.
Argentina ranks 14th and Kazakhstan ranks 12th of 187 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Argentina averaged higher in 3 and Kazakhstan in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Argentina | Kazakhstan |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 2.32 million LSU | 971,058 LSU | 1.35 million LSU | Argentina |
| 2000s | 2.53 million LSU | 743,037 LSU | 1.79 million LSU | Argentina |
| 2010s | 2.10 million LSU | 1.33 million LSU | 767,662 LSU | Argentina |
| 2020s | 1.69 million LSU | 2.33 million LSU | 642,315 LSU | Kazakhstan |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The Livestock Patterns domain of FAOSTAT contains data on livestock numbers, shares of major livestock species and densities of livestock units in the agricultural land area. Values are calculated using Livestock Units (LSU), which facilitate aggregating information for different livestock types. Data are available by country, with global coverage, for the period 1961 to the most recent year available with annual updates. This methodology applies the LSU coefficients reported in the "Guidelines for the preparation of livestock sector reviews" (FAO, 2011). From this publication, LSU coefficients are computed by livestock type and by country. The reference unit used for the calculation of livestock units (=1 LSU) is the grazing equivalent of one adult dairy cow producing 3000 kg of milk annually, fed without additional concentrated foodstuffs. FAOSTAT agri-environmental indicators on livestock patterns closely follow the structure of the indicators in EUROSTAT.
